Laser energy is superimposed onto Gas Destabilization Process to aid Electron Extraction
Laser energy (v), shown in Figure 1-1, is injected into or superimposed onto the Gas Destabilization Process to help promote the Electron Extraction Process, since absorbed light (electromagnetic) energy forces gas atom electrons to a higher energy state, weakening the attraction-force (qq') between orbital electrons and the nucleus, as illustrated in Figure 1-5 (Figure 20JX).
